Change the Span ToString semantics to return the contents for T=char (#16143)

src/mscorlib/shared/System/ReadOnlySpan.cs
src/mscorlib/shared/System/Span.cs

index 56d0ad9..a7d1736 100644 (file)
@@ -251,9 +251,21 @@ namespace System
         }
 
         /// <summary>
-        /// Returns a <see cref="String"/> with the name of the type and the number of elements
+        /// For <see cref="ReadOnlySpan{Char}"/>, returns a new instance of string that represents the characters pointed to by the span.
+        /// Otherwise, returns a <see cref="String"/> with the name of the type and the number of elements.
         /// </summary>
-        public override string ToString() => string.Format("System.ReadOnlySpan<{0}>[{1}]", typeof(T).Name, _length);
+        public override string ToString()
+        {
+            if (typeof(T) == typeof(char))
+            {
+                unsafe
+                {
+                    fixed (char* src = &Unsafe.As<T, char>(ref _pointer.Value))
+                        return new string(src, 0, _length);
+                }
+            }
+            return string.Format("System.ReadOnlySpan<{0}>[{1}]", typeof(T).Name, _length);
+        }
